Advantages and Disadvantages of Using Words with "Lock"

While words with "lock" offer a rich tapestry of meaning, it's worth considering their subtle nuances.

AdvantagesDisadvantages
Convey security and stabilityCan imply rigidity or inflexibility
Suggest finality and commitmentMight create a sense of permanence that's undesirable in some contexts
Add a sense of intrigue or mysteryCan sometimes sound overly formal or archaic

Best Practices for Using Words with "Lock" Effectively

Here are some tips to help you wield the power of "lock" with finesse:

  1. Context is Key: Consider the overall tone and message you want to convey. While "lock in" might be perfect for a business deal, it might feel too strong for a casual agreement.
  2. Balance is Crucial: Avoid overusing words with "lock," as it can make your writing sound repetitive or heavy-handed.
  3. Embrace Variety: Explore synonyms and related terms to add nuance and depth to your language. Instead of always saying "locked," consider using "secured," "fastened," or "sealed."
  4. Consider Connotations: Be mindful of the subtle implications of different "lock" words. "Deadlock" carries a more negative connotation than "stalemate," for instance.
  5. Read Aloud: Hearing your words spoken aloud can help you identify any awkward or unnatural uses of "lock" terms.
